Common Furnace Problems We Fix

Common Furnace Problems MBM Diagnoses and Repairs in Philipsburg, PA

Furnace Not Turning On in Philipsburg

Failed igniter. Failed flame sensor preventing the gas valve from opening. Tripped high-limit switch from a previous overheating event. Failed control board. Thermostat wiring fault or failed thermostat. Gas supply issue in Philipsburg, PA. MBM diagnoses no-heat situations systematically beginning with the most common and correctable causes in Philipsburg.

Furnace Starts Then Shuts Off After a Few Seconds in Philipsburg, PA

A furnace that initiates the startup sequence and shuts off within seconds almost always has a flame sensor problem in Philipsburg. The furnace ignites the burners, the flame sensor fails to confirm the flame within the safety window, and the control board shuts the gas valve as a safety measure in Philipsburg, PA. Flame sensor cleaning or replacement addresses this in most cases in Philipsburg.

Furnace Running but Not Producing Heat in Philipsburg

Failed igniter running the blower without lighting the burners. Gas valve not opening despite the igniter firing. Burner ports contaminated enough that the flame is not establishing correctly in Philipsburg, PA. MBM diagnoses the specific combustion fault before recommending any repair in Philipsburg.

Insufficient Heat — System Runs but Home Stays Cold in Philipsburg, PA

Contaminated heat exchanger reducing thermal efficiency. Dirty burners producing incomplete combustion and reduced heat output. Duct system leakage delivering conditioned air to unconditioned spaces. Or a system that is undersized for the home's actual heat loss in cold weather in Philipsburg.

Furnace Short Cycling in Philipsburg

The most common cause is the high-limit switch tripping because restricted airflow is causing the heat exchanger to overheat in Philipsburg, PA. A dirty air filter severely restricting return airflow is the most common cause of limit switch tripping in Philipsburg.

Burning or Unusual Smells From the Furnace in Philipsburg, PA

A persistent burning smell that does not clear, a burning plastic smell indicating an electrical fault, or a rotten egg or sulfur smell indicating a gas leak are situations requiring the furnace to be shut off and MBM called immediately in Philipsburg. Do not operate the furnace with any persistent or concerning smell until it has been assessed in Philipsburg, PA.

Unusual Noises From the Furnace in Philipsburg

A banging or booming sound at startup indicates delayed ignition from dirty burners in Philipsburg, PA. A squealing sound from the air handler indicates a failing blower motor bearing in Philipsburg. A rattling sound during operation may indicate a loose heat exchanger component in Philipsburg, PA.

What Causes Furnace Failures

What Causes Furnace Failures in Philipsburg, PA

Failed or Dirty Flame Sensor in Philipsburg

The flame sensor confirms a flame is present before the control board allows the gas valve to stay open in Philipsburg, PA. Oxidation on the sensor rod reduces its electrical conductivity over time, causing a signal too weak to satisfy the control board in Philipsburg. The control board shuts the gas valve as a safety measure, producing the furnace that starts and shuts off within seconds symptom in Philipsburg, PA.

Failed Hot Surface Igniter in Philipsburg, PA

The hot surface igniter is a fragile ceramic component that glows red-hot to ignite the gas burners in Philipsburg. Igniters become brittle over time from thermal cycling and crack or fail from physical shock in Philipsburg, PA. A failed igniter produces no glow and no ignition in Philipsburg.

Cracked Heat Exchanger in Philipsburg

The heat exchanger separates the combustion gases from the circulated air in Philipsburg, PA. A cracked heat exchanger allows combustion gases including carbon monoxide to cross into the circulated air and be distributed throughout the home by the blower in Philipsburg. A confirmed cracked heat exchanger means the furnace should not be operated until the heat exchanger or furnace is replaced in Philipsburg, PA.

Blower Motor and Capacitor Failure in Philipsburg, PA

A failed blower motor produces no airflow despite the combustion system operating correctly, causing the heat exchanger to overheat and the high-limit switch to trip in Philipsburg. A failing blower capacitor causes the motor to struggle to start or fail to start entirely in Philipsburg, PA.

Control Board and Thermostat Faults in Philipsburg

The control board manages ignition sequencing, blower timing, safety switch monitoring, and fault code storage in Philipsburg, PA. A failed control board can produce a wide range of symptoms depending on which function it was managing in Philipsburg.

Limit Switch Trips From Overheating in Philipsburg, PA

The high-limit switch shuts the furnace off if the heat exchanger temperature exceeds the safe maximum in Philipsburg. It trips consistently when the heat exchanger is reaching unsafe temperatures, almost always from restricted airflow in Philipsburg, PA. A dirty air filter is the most common cause in Philipsburg.

A banging or booming sound at furnace startup indicates delayed ignition in Philipsburg. Gas accumulates in the combustion chamber before the burners ignite because the burner ports are partially blocked by combustion deposits in Philipsburg, PA. When ignition finally occurs, the accumulated gas ignites with a small explosion in Philipsburg. Delayed ignition is hard on the heat exchanger and warrants prompt burner cleaning in Philipsburg, PA.
Yes. A severely restricted air filter reduces the airflow through the heat exchanger below the minimum required for safe operation in Philipsburg. The heat exchanger temperature rises to the point where the high-limit switch trips and shuts the furnace off in Philipsburg, PA. Replacing the filter allows the furnace to restart in Philipsburg.
